  1. What exactly does my insurance policy cover?

Let’s say, you have been recommended to go with certain insurance products for your business. It is important to make sure you ask the agent to explain in detail, what the policy covers. This can help you make sure the policy meets your needs, as well as that you understand what your responsibilities are in order to maintain this coverage over time.

An added benefit of working with the same agent over time, is that they can provide ongoing support and be in touch with you should any changes come up – or there are any other details that require your attention.

2. Can I take advantage of a multi-policy service?

Another great question to ask relates to the idea of having one or more policies through the same broker. For example, if you already have your business policy through the broker, you may also want to add in vehicle insurance and even home insurance. This way your broker can help you manage all of these policies ‘under the same roof’

Sometimes, bundling is also an option, and there is an opportunity to receive discounts and reduced fees by doing so. It never hurts to explore this possibility by asking, as it can have many benefits for you.

3. Do I need to extend my coverage based on where my property is located? (ie. flood zones, wild fires, etc).

Last, but not least is the question of extending your coverage. With all of the extreme weather events we have seen across Canada in recent years, another key piece to your insurance is taking into account if you reside or work in a region that is susceptible to floods, fires, and other potentially damaging seasonal conditions.

Making sure you have added the necessary coverage can help to give you the extra peace of mind you need. And should anything like this happen, your business – and your livelihood is well protected.
